During his address at the United Nations General Assembly, Donald Trump sharply criticized what he called the "green energy" movement, referring to it as a "scam" and a "con job." He claimed that countries pursuing green energy policies are destined for economic failure.
Climate Change as a "Con Job"
In his speech, Trump dismissed climate change as "the greatest con job ever perpetrated on the world." He argued that predictions made by the United Nations and other groups about climate change have been consistently wrong and were created by "stupid people that have cost their countries fortunes."He also claimed that the concept of a "carbon footprint" is a hoax.
The Dangers of Green Energy
Trump specifically warned against the shift to renewable energy sources, stating, "If you don't get away from this green scam, your country is going to fail." He criticized what he saw as a growing dependence on renewables, mockingly calling them a "costly failure." He advocated for the use of "traditional energy sources" as a path to national prosperity. Trump also made a point to celebrate the increased drilling for oil and natural gas in the United States under his administration.
A "Double-Tailed Monster"
Trump linked the pursuit of green energy to immigration policies, calling them a "double-tailed monster" that destroys countries. In his view, both are misguided, destructive policies that threaten national sovereignty and economic stability.
